Chemring Group PLC has reached agreement with Siemens to acquire Roke Manor Research Ltd., a centre for advanced technology research and development based in Hampshire, UK.

Working in collaboration with government agencies, consortia and industrial partners, Roke has established a world class reputation for developing and delivering innovative advanced sensors, signal processing, communications and network solutions in the defence, security and industrial markets.

Commenting on the announcement, David Smith, Managing Director of Roke, said, "Joining the Chemring Group will provide the independence and investment required to enable our continued growth. Our focus remains on leading innovation in communications, information systems and electronic sensor technology."

Chemring is a global defence business listed that specializes in the manufacture of energetic material products, providing solutions for highly demanding requirements in the countermeasures, counter-IED, pyrotechnics and munitions markets.

The company’s Chief Executive, David Price, commented, "The acquisition of Roke will substantially enhance our existing technologies in a number of our key market sectors and will provide a growing number of products and technologies that will allow the Group to enter adjacent attractive, high growth markets. I am delighted that all of the existing highly successful Roke management team will remain with the company."
